Just got a 'phone call from TOT. They said that in future if you download torrents for 24 hours continuously they'll cut your connection. You only need to disconnect and reconnect to continue downloading. Apparently it's something to do with people downloading then going away for a few days. (At least that was the explanation.)

Of course, this sounds totally pointless and crazy - but of course, this is TOT we're talking about. But has anyone else had a similar 'phone call?
